I've now got the navigation system fully set up correctly. However, It has got me wondering about their code. They have it set up to do a 3D transform on the map as you are driving, to tilt the map as speed increases, so that the player can see more ahead. But to me it feels like they might have borked that slightly, since when combined with the rotation of the car, it just doesn't look right. Maybe its just me, but take a proper look at how the map is rotating and moving on the official vehicles navigation units and see for yourself.

Electric motors have been in the game for quite a while now. Its basically the same as a normal engine as far as BeamNG is concerned. It just needs batteries as a fuel source rather than petrol or diesel. Not much has changed about how electric motors work in the update, however there is now a proper controller for them which can handle multiple electric motors gracefully. However, the new electric sound effects do make a huge difference in how electric cars feel to drive in game.
